Liverpool's injury list lengthened during the first half of Saturday's win over Brighton as Joe Gomez was forced off. Gomez is one of several Liverpool players who are currently injured and Arne Slot gave an update on a few of them after the game against Brighton.
"If I have a player who goes off with a muscle injury like Joe, that's normally not a positive thing," Slot told club media after Liverpool's win over Brighton. "I would not expect him to be in the squad next week [at Tottenham Hotspur].
